# Requirements

## Salesforce B2B Commerce Requirements

You must meet the following requirements before you can integrate the App.

* You must have enterprise-level org permissions and system admin rights to install the Salesforce B2B Commerce App.
* Only install the App on the Enterprise and Unlimited versions of Salesforce.
* Install B2B Commerce on the system before you install this application.
* Enable Communities in the Salesforce version before you install this application.
* Before you [install the Salesforce B2B Commerce App](https://docs.digitalriver.com/salesforce-b2b/2.1.1-2/integrating-the-digital-river-salesforce-b2b-commerce-app/step-1-install-the-salesforce-b2b-commerce-app), map your B2B Customer profile to provide the appropriate access and permissions.‌ \
  ![](https://2309602074-files.gitbook.io/~/files/v0/b/gitbook-legacy-files/o/assets%2F-MNZuPvN3iGOwRD0PjQh%2F-MRQTpCStV3nY-Ch7NZa%2F-MRQbgAoqsKnTUDYu3g9%2FRequirements1.png?alt=media\&token=e0f8eb76-23c8-40a0-b1fa-f3a4c00e720c)​
* Obtain your public and secret key from your Digital River Business Development Manager. You will need this when you [configure the Salesforce B2B Commerce App](https://docs.digitalriver.com/salesforce-b2b/2.1.1-2/integrating-the-digital-river-salesforce-b2b-commerce-app/step-3-configure-the-salesforce-b2b-commerce-app).

​
